        I do see a piling on Joshua that clearly was not happening prior to this fight. Considering how many fighters have been upset in their careers- you know, like 90% of them- that recovered just fine and redeemed themselves with still great careers, I personally think Joshua has gone from being overrated to underrated. A month ago, he was perceived to be the universal #1 HW even though he had some stamina and technical weaknesses. Now, everyone has him as a glass jawed slacker that never earned anything in the ring despite a strong resume for this era, which admittedly is not very deep but is better than during the Larry Holmes dominated run or the Klitschko stretch. To me, he just seemed distracted and mentally "blah" that night. It seems to be more of a Joshua bad night than that much of a Ruiz is great one. Ruiz has got some skills. We all knew that. Most on this site felt he beat Joseph Parker. I have yet to find the poster who did not think he was a step up from the blow hard doper he replaced. But Ruiz is limited. Joshua STILL has better tools, more power, and all the advantages physically he had going into the first fight. It was his effort that blew.

        If he still wants to be a boxer, I think he beats Ruiz in the rematch. If he has lost interest, than anyone would have beat him and Ruiz had the perfect timing.
